The customer provides hosted SBC solution in a cloud, SBC is like a SIP firewall that can block attacks even before they reach the customer network . The service protect SIP based PBX, by routing remote calls (remote extensions, sip trunks and incoming DID numbers) via the SBC, the calls can be monitored, analyzed and alert on real time. Subscribes can define a list of rules for every call or sip traffic passing through the SBC to his PBX. The service enable the customer to open his firewall only to sip-protect service, so his server is always protected behind the
Read More
Archives for custom development
Disposable number
The customer provide a disposable/second number for incoming/outgoing/SMS, for privacy/business. For this project we’ve build a registration server, load balancer, media server and push services. The registration and load balancer was based on opensips platform, it handled registration from a mobile sip clients and load balanced incoming and outgoing calls through multiple media servers(asterisk). When a call request came in, we activated a web service to check the end-user preferences, if he allow incoming calls based on caller-id or time of day, and if so, perform a push notification to the endpoint and then route the call in.
Read More
Roaming and caller-id unblocking
Caller-id un-blocker/roaming solution. The platform was based on opensips loadbalancer, registrar server and asterisk cluster. The platform designed to auto-scale(up and down) based on load, and included a push server for the mobile sip clients.
Read More
MVNO mobile provider
MVNO self service and network announcements. The scope was to build high availability self service IVR and network announcements. The platform was based on master-master mysql server, two opensips servers for load balancing and sip error mapping and asterisk servers. We’ve built a fully redundant network without a single point of failure. The service designed to serve as a self-service by phone, customers are calling to the platform and can listen to their current balance(voice, sms, data), can purchase a new plan, when all actions are performed in real time via API to the billing platform. We made the API
Read More
Voip application server
Scalable and redundant telephony apps cloud. The customer provide a unique solution for providing voice applications like trivia games, message board and a “what’s up” like voice application. The platform included a billing system for outgoing and incoming calls, sip load balancing and voice application servers. The system was capable of handling hundreds of simultaneous calls, perform billing per call-in and out, DID billing and revenue share. The application server included functions like multi channel conf rooms, voicemails, forwarding to landline, ring groups, API to external services, voice announcements, multi level IVR, survey, calls broadcast and more. The platform was
Read More
Global roaming
The customer provide a unique roaming solution based on virtual numbers and a mobile application over a cellular network. Docker based platform. For this project we’ve built a full docker platform, separating the web, database, opensips and multiple asterisk servers to stand-alone containers. The platform is serving service providers to lower roaming costs using sip application and push notification. The system has a full call control API, each incoming call was controlled using external API,including hold, answer, indicate ringing, hangup, etc.
Read More
International and PBX voip provider
The customer provides virtual numbers, hosted PBX, and voip application services. The customer had a multi-server environment, We provided 3’rd level support to the NOC and dev team, consulting in general structure and flows. In addition, we provided the customer a load balancing platform that balances between sip providers and voip application servers.
Read More
MNO – mobile provider
The customer is one of the leading mobile operator in Israel. Presence server. The customer had an old SIP platform with no presence support. We’ve built two services, an API service and an opensips sip presence server. Together with the customer dev team we built an API that get notifications from the core SIP server and push them to an opensips server. The opensips server handled all the subscriptions and notifications from the sip endpoints. When an endpoint boot up it subscribed to the opensips to get notifications(BLF) of other SIP endpoints, the opensips communicated with the API service and
Read More
MVNO, international carrier, wholesale voip
In this project we’ve served as external CTO from the first days of the company. The customer was a Romanian MVNO and international voice provider. We’ve implemented a carrier grade billing platform and develop all the company products: Self made calling card platform based on asterisk and API to the billing platform. Sip clients(some developed in-house). hosted PBX solution for forex companies. We were in charge of building the company web site, accounting and invoicing platform(self made), implementation of credit-card processing including recurring services and alerting. As part of the web project we implemented mail campaign platform, voucher mechanism, ticketing
Read More
PBX & call center provider
The customer is a leading on-premise and cloud call center provider. Design global routing platform in order to integrate multiple DID and voice providers and multi location PBX with carrier grade billing platform. The platform act also as an SBC, protecting the network from SIP scanners, brute force attacks, also providing a load balancing for outgoing traffic from PBX customers to the billing platform. Build “one click” PBX install script that take a clean linux OS and install all necessary applications, plugins, firewall scripts, mail, web and other internal applications. Design a multi-tenant PBX platform, working with the customer dev
Read More
